Description
Pentreath Individual Placement and Support (IPS)
Total Quantity or Scope
The intention in 24/25 was for CFT to use the £171k to sub-contract to Pentreath; however their current expenditure to Pentreath under the existing contract has exceeded thresholds. This has led to them being unable to direct award the funding before the end of the year, placing the funding at risk of being unused and returned to DWP. This will then impact on 25/26 delivery and the workforce availability.The ICB is being asked to direct Award to Pentreath to ensure the funding is spent in sufficient time and to ensure the workforce is recruited.CFT will then plan to procure the support under a larger contract with Pentreath in 25/26. CFT intend to run a full procurement.The ICB would direct award for one year.Due to CFT handing back the contract as they are going to the market in order to address urgent quality/safety concerns pose risks to patients or the public and necessitate rapid changes and to re-award to an existing contract holderAward needed to be made urgently due to CFT not being able to go to the market for 25/26 this was unforseeable by the ICB and delay in this urgent provision would pose a risk to patients and service users.Lifetime value: £171,000Contract Dates: 01/12/2024 - 30/11/2025. Additional information: This contract has been awarded under the urgent circumstances provision of the Provider Selection Regime (PSR). This contract has been awarded under the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the provisions of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 do not apply to this award.Due to CFT handing back the contract as they are going to the market in order to address urgent quality/safety concerns pose risks to patients or the public and necessitate rapid changes and to re-award to an existing contract holder.
